Introduction:
From the source during the early nineteenth century to its quickly evolving form into the twenty-first century, poker has actually undeniably become a worldwide feeling. Utilizing the advent of technology, the original card online game has actually transitioned to the digital realm, fascinating scores of players through internet poker systems. This report explores the fascinating world of internet poker, its benefits, downsides, while the reasons for its growing popularity.

Body:

1. Accessibility and Ease:
One of many major known reasons for the widespread selling point of on-line poker is its availability. In contrast to brick-and-mortar gambling enterprises, on-line poker platforms offer people the freedom to try out when, anywhere. With a stable net connection, poker lovers can enjoy a common online game without leaving their houses, eliminating the necessity for travel. Additionally, on-line poker websites supply an array of choices, including various variants of poker, tournaments, and various share amounts, providing to players of most skill amounts.

2. International Player Base:
Online poker transcends geographical boundaries, enabling people from all corners associated with world to compete against both. This interconnectedness fosters a diverse and challenging environment, allowing people to try their particular skills against opponents with different methods and playing designs. Moreover, online poker systems often feature radiant communities in which people can talk about strategies, share experiences, and participate in friendly competition.

3. Lower Costs and Smaller Stakes:
Compared to conventional casinos, playing poker highstakes online can considerably reduce costs. On line platforms have reduced expense expenditures, letting them provide reduced stakes and paid off entry charges for tournaments. This will make online poker available to a wider market, including newbies and informal players, just who could find the large stakes of real time casinos daunting. The ability to have fun with smaller stakes also provides a feeling of economic security, allowing people to handle their money more effectively.

4. Improved Game Access and Variety:
Internet poker systems offer an enormous array of online game options and variants. Whether it's texas holdem, Omaha, or Seven-Card Stud, people will get their preferred game easily and immediately. More over, on the web platforms usually introduce brand-new poker variants, spicing up the gameplay and maintaining the knowledge fresh for people. The option of numerous tables and tournaments helps to ensure that players always find suitable options and never having to wait for a seat at a table.

5. Challenges and Drawbacks:
While online poker brings many benefits, it is really not without its difficulties. The major downsides is the prospect of fraudulent tasks, including collusion and chip dumping, where people cheat to gain an unfair benefit. But reputable online poker systems employ powerful security measures and random number generators to thwart these types of behavior. Additionally, some players may find the absence of physical cues and communications being part of live poker games a disadvantage, as they can be more difficult to learn opponents and use emotional strategies on the web.
